§ 102-a. Small business regulation guides.
1.For each rule or group\nof related rules which significantly impact a substantial number of\nsmall businesses, the agency which adopted the rule shall post on its\nwebsite one or more guides explaining the actions a small business may\ntake to comply with such rule or group of rules if the agency determines\nthat such guide or guides will assist small businesses in complying with\nthe rule, and shall designate each such posting as a "small business\nregulation guide".
